Closed on Christmas
I don't believe it is known yet. Some of the people at the restaurant may know, but you would need to ask them. I'm sure after the weekend they will have a schedule up for Christmas. They are most likely going to be closed Christmas night, but I have no idea.
Thanks! Your answer is awaiting moderation.